Abstract

The present disclosure reports solid forms of ((S)-5-((1-(6-chloro-2-oxo-1,2-dihydroquinolin-3-yl)ethyl)amino)-1-methyl-6-oxo-1,6-dihydropyridine-2-carbonitrile.

Claims (24)

1 - 20 . (canceled)

21 . A solid form of Compound 1:

Compound 1

characterized by an X-ray Powder Diffraction (XRPD) having diffractions at angles (2 theta+0.2) of 6.3, 23.6, and 27.8.

22 . The solid form of claim 21 characterized by an X-ray Powder Diffraction (XRPD) having diffractions at angles (2 theta+0.2) of 6.3, 23.6, and 27.8, corresponding to d-spacing (angstroms±0.2) of 14.0, 3.8, and 3.2, respectively.

23 . The solid form of claim 21 characterized by a differential scanning calorimetry (DSC) thermogram with an endothermic event observed at about 256.6° C.

24 . The solid form of claim 22 characterized by a differential scanning calorimetry (DSC) thermogram with an endothermic event observed at about 256.6° C.

25 . The solid form of claim 21 characterized by a dynamic vapor sorption (DVS) showing maximum water uptake of 0.25% w/w at 25° C./90% RH.

26 . The solid form of claim 22 characterized by a dynamic vapor sorption (DVS) showing maximum water uptake of 0.25% w/w at 25° C./90% RH.

27 . The solid form of claim 21 , characterized by a DSC endothermic event at about 256.6° C., wherein the DSC is obtained by heating at 10° C./min from about 20° C. to about 300° C. using dry nitrogen to purge the system and the following parameters:

Parameters

DSC

Pan Type

Aluminum pan, closed

Temperature

RT-250° C.

Ramp rate

10° C./min

Purge gas

N 2

28 . A solid form of olutasidenib, characterized by at least one of the following characteristics:

(i) an X-ray Powder Diffraction (XRPD) having diffractions at angles (2 theta±0.2) of 6.3, 23.6, and 27.8;

(ii) a differential scanning calorimetry (DSC) thermogram with an endothermic event observed at about 256.6° C.; and

(iii) a dynamic vapor sorption (DVS) showing maximum water uptake of 0.25% w/w at 25° C./90% RH.
